Limestone Branch Minor Case Rye
Had master distiller M.C. Beam not been stifled by Prohibition, we imagine his straight rye whiskey would taste a lot like the mature elixir we bottle today. It's aged in cream sherry casks for an unforgettable flavor.
 51% Rye | 45% Corn | 4% Malted Barley | High Corn

Tasting Notes
Nose: Earthy notes, sweet sherry, rye spice.
Palate: Hint of sweet butterscotch, caramel, cherry, raisin and a touch of rye spice.
Finish: Long, smooth, with hints of dried fruits.
High West Double Rye!
Double Rye! is a blend of two different rye whiskeys. It is also crafted to be twice as spicy (think cinnamon, nutmeg, and cloves) as your average rye whiskey. We recommend trying a Double Rye! Manhattan or Old Fashioned - it's also absolutely superb for sipping alone or sharing with other cowboys and good-looking strangers.
 Mashbill Undisclosed | >51% Rye | High Corn

Tasting Notes
Nose: Mint, clove, cinnamon, licorice root, pine nuts, and dark chocolate, with a surprising dose of gin botanicals throughout.
Palate: Rye spices up front, then menthol, mint, eucalyptus, herbal tea with wildflower honey and allspice.
Finish: Cinnamon and mint, gradually sweetening through the finish, with a hint of anise.
